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Logística Frete Embarcador

Linha de Produto:

Linha Datasul

Segmento:

Logística

Módulo:

TOTVS Frete Embarcador - Gestão de Frete Embarcador (SIGAGFE)

Função:CDF003A
País:Brasil
Ticket:23882988
Requisito/Story/Issue (informe o requisito relacionado) :DLOGGFE-22436


02. SITUAÇÃO/REQUISITO


Inclusão de novo ponto upc referente ao envio do peso para o GFE. Através desse ponto, será possível alterar o peso, quando necessário, e enviar para a simulação no GFE.

03. SOLUÇÃO

Incluído novo ponto de entrada.


Ponto de entrada executado a partir do programa CDF003A:

                    IF  c-nom-prog-upc-mg97 <> "":U 
                    AND c-nom-prog-upc-mg97 <> ? THEN DO:
                    

                        RUN VALUE(c-nom-prog-upc-mg97) (INPUT "AlteraPeso",      
                                                        INPUT "CONTAINER",                        
                                                        INPUT THIS-PROCEDURE,                   
                                                        INPUT ?,       
                                                        INPUT STRING(tt-ped-item.nome-abrev)   + "|" 
                                                            + string(tt-ped-item.nr-pedcli)    + "|"
                                                            + string(tt-ped-item.nr-sequencia) + "|"                                                            
                                                            + STRING(tt-ped-item.it-codigo)    + "|"
                                                            + STRING(tt-ped-item.cod-refer)    + "|"                                                            
                                                            + STRING(de-peso-bruto)            + "|"
                                                            + STRING(de-altura)                + "|"
                                                            + string(de-largura)               + "|"
                                                            + string(de-comprim)               + "|",
                                                        INPUT ?).    

                          IF  ENTRY(1,RETURN-VALUE,"|") = "AlteraPeso" THEN DO:
                              ASSIGN de-peso-bruto =  dec(ENTRY(2,RETURN-VALUE,"|"))
                                     de-altura     =  dec(ENTRY(3,RETURN-VALUE,"|"))
                                     de-largura    =  dec(ENTRY(4,RETURN-VALUE,"|"))
                                     de-comprim    =  dec(ENTRY(5,RETURN-VALUE,"|")).
                          END.
                     END.                                        

04. DEMAIS INFORMAÇÕES

DI Integração Datasul 12 x Protheus SIGAGFE

05. ASSUNTOS RELACIONADOS